    Cory, put together a small backpack with hand warmers, extra gloves, flashlight and emergency blankets oh yeah from my old basic training knowledge an extra pair of heavy socks. For tools, a small entrenching shovel, three ways of starting a fire, matches, a lighter and a knife with starter rod (remember 0ne is none and two is one when looking a fire starting stuff.) Next NEVER go alone like that again, always the two man rule. Oh yeah buy a cheap pair of Radio Shack two way radios always good when the cell phone dies on you. Lastly a good .38 or .357 handgun / revolvers WILL NOT jam and always go boom when you need them too. Have I scared you enough, Captain Mike over & out!
